Background
With the development of the traffic industry, at present, in order to safely and timely master the road conditions, monitoring rods are arranged on various roads, the monitoring rods mainly comprise supporting rods and monitoring rods, monitoring equipment such as a camera device is usually installed on the monitoring rods, the areas where the monitoring rods are located are monitored in good time, and new monitoring numbers are transmitted to interrupt processing.

In a preferred embodiment, the connecting rods are arranged oppositely, the fixing frame is of an L-shaped structure, and a rectangular pull ring is fixedly mounted in the middle of the front wall and the rear wall of the balancing weight.
In a preferred embodiment, the top of the balancing weight is in threaded connection with a screw, the screw is extruded at the top of the fixing frame, the number of the balancing weight is not less than three, and the balancing weight is in a rectangular structure.
In a preferred embodiment, the first magnet and the second magnet have opposite polarities, and the second magnet is matched with the positioning groove.
In a preferred embodiment, the cavity and the limiting groove are of a communicating structure, the limiting plate is matched with the limiting groove, and the sliding block is matched with the sliding groove.
In a preferred embodiment, the joints of the screw rod, the monitoring rod and the cavity are all mounted through bearings, a pin is inserted into the turntable, a pin hole is formed in the position, opposite to the pin, of the monitoring rod, and the pin is inserted into the pin hole.

The working principle is as follows:
in this application, through the pull ring of portable balancing weight 8 preceding back wall fixed mounting, can transport on control pole 4 with balancing weight 8, cup joint balancing weight 8 on mount 7, through adjusting the balancing weight 8 of the interval of balancing weight 8 on mount 7 or changing different weight, can adjust the balance between bracing piece 1 and the control pole 4, adjust the completion back, rotate the screw on the balancing weight 8, make the screw extrusion on mount 7, can carry out spacing fixed to the position of balancing weight 8.
